Output 58f4c5d40d1e58786ed89edf88827e3fb333bbce943dcd55f0f53ced900c4920:0

value
25307722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6404862dcf3ed8f681dae724737d6fae3d5b79ec OP_EQUAL
address
MH21DxPNuryKtQDK3rLSpuE11dEApDBRyJ
transaction
58f4c5d40d1e58786ed89edf88827e3fb333bbce943dcd55f0f53ced900c4920
spent
true